Subject: [dpdk-dev] [PATCH v4 3/3] net/mlx5: update modify header using Direct Verbs
Date: Wed, 10 Apr 2019 14:50:43 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<5f78a685ccfa825f104fcdcf8d8f58aab5b3adc2.1554896841.git.dekelp@mellanox.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<cover.1554896841.git.dekelp@mellanox.com>

This patch implements additional actions of packet header
modifications.

Add actions:
- INC_TCP_SEQ - Increase sequence number in the outermost TCP header.
- DEC_TCP_SEQ - Decrease sequence number in the outermost TCP header.
- INC_TCP_ACK - Increase acknowledgment number in the outermost TCP
		header.
- DEC_TCP_ACK - Decrease acknowledgment number in the outermost TCP
		header.

Original work by Xiaoyu Min.

 /**
+ * Convert modify-header increment/decrement TCP Sequence number
+ * to DV specification.
+ *
+ * @param[in,out] resource
+ *   Pointer to the modify-header resource.
+ * @param[in] action
+ *   Pointer to action specification.
+ * @param[out] error
+ *   Pointer to the error structure.
+ *
+ * @return
+ *   0 on success, a negative errno value otherwise and rte_errno is set.
+ */
+static int
+flow_dv_convert_action_modify_tcp_seq
+			(struct mlx5_flow_dv_modify_hdr_resource *resource,
+			 const struct rte_flow_action *action,
+			 struct rte_flow_error *error)
+{
+	const struct rte_flow_general_action *conf =
+		(const struct rte_flow_general_action *)(action->conf);
+	uint64_t value = rte_be_to_cpu_32(conf->integer.be32);
+	struct rte_flow_item item;
+	struct rte_flow_item_tcp tcp;
+	struct rte_flow_item_tcp tcp_mask;
+
+	memset(&tcp, 0, sizeof(tcp));
+	memset(&tcp_mask, 0, sizeof(tcp_mask));
+	if (action->type == RTE_FLOW_ACTION_TYPE_DEC_TCP_SEQ)
+		/*
+		 * The HW has no decrement operation, only increment operation.
+		 * To simulate decrement X from Y using increment operation
+		 * we need to add UINT32_MAX X times to Y.
+		 * Each adding of UINT32_MAX decrements Y by 1.
+		 */
+		value *= UINT32_MAX;
+	tcp.hdr.sent_seq = rte_cpu_to_be_32((uint32_t)value);
+	tcp_mask.hdr.sent_seq = RTE_BE32(UINT32_MAX);
+	item.type = RTE_FLOW_ITEM_TYPE_TCP;
+	item.spec = &tcp;
+	item.mask = &tcp_mask;
+	return flow_dv_convert_modify_action(&item, modify_tcp, resource,
+					     MLX5_MODIFICATION_TYPE_ADD, error);
+}
